Train collision near Bedford leaves 28 in hospital

Serious collision on key commuter corridor

The collision occurred on the evening of 19 June 2026 on the Midland Main Line south of Bedford, a vital rail artery linking London with towns and cities in the English Midlands. According to published coverage, one southbound East Midlands Railway service and another passenger train were involved in the impact, which took place on a section of track that carries thousands of commuters and long-distance travelers each day.

Initial reports indicate that one person died at the scene, while dozens more sustained injuries of varying severity. Emergency services transported 28 passengers to hospitals across the region, where nine are described in public reporting as being in critical condition. Others were treated at the scene for more minor wounds and shock.

Images carried by international and British media show a line of carriages halted on the track near open fields, with multiple fire engines, ambulances, and specialized rescue vehicles positioned alongside the railway. Floodlighting was erected to support overnight operations as responders worked in difficult conditions to reach and stabilize the injured.

Rescue operation and medical response

Publicly available information shows that a large-scale emergency response was activated shortly after the collision, with regional ambulance, fire, and police services joined by specialist rail incident teams. Medical staff established triage areas close to the tracks to prioritize treatment before patients were transferred to hospitals in Bedfordshire and surrounding counties.

Reports from national broadcasters describe passengers helping one another to move through darkened carriages, some of which had suffered visible structural damage. Rescue crews used cutting equipment and ladders in certain areas to assist people from elevated or twisted sections of rolling stock, while others were guided along trackside walkways to waiting vehicles.

Hospitals across the region enacted major incident protocols to manage the sudden influx of patients. According to news coverage, injuries range from fractures and internal trauma to lacerations and concussion. The nine patients categorized as critical are receiving intensive care, and medical teams are expected to carry out further assessments in the coming days as the full picture of long-term impacts becomes clearer.

Disruption for rail passengers in and out of London

The collision has caused extensive disruption to services on one of Britain’s busiest intercity and commuter routes. According to operator statements reported in the press, trains between London St Pancras and destinations including Bedford, Wellingborough, Kettering, Corby, Nottingham, and Sheffield faced cancellations and significant delays through the night and into the next day.

Passengers were advised through media bulletins to check live information before traveling, with some services diverted and others terminating short of their planned destinations. Replacement buses were arranged for sections of the route, although capacity constraints and extended journey times created challenges for both local travelers and those connecting to long-distance services and international flights.

Early focus on investigation and safety implications

According to published coverage, the national rail accident investigation body has opened a full inquiry into the Bedford collision. Investigators are expected to examine onboard data recorders, signaling logs, communications between drivers and control centers, and the physical condition of track and rolling stock to determine the sequence of events leading up to the impact.

Specialist teams will also take account of witness statements from passengers and railway staff, as well as any available CCTV footage from platforms, nearby infrastructure, and inside the trains. Their work is likely to explore a range of factors, including train speed, braking behavior, signaling performance, and any potential human or technical errors.
